import type * as T from "../../../../Effect/index.js"; import type * as C from "../core.js"; export declare function acquireReleaseWith_(acquire: T.Effect, use: (a: Acquired) => C.Channel, release: (a: Acquired) => T.RIO): C.Channel; /** * @ets_data_first acquireReleaseWith_ */ export declare function acquireReleaseWith(use: (a: Acquired) => C.Channel, release: (a: Acquired) => T.RIO): (acquire: T.Effect) => C.Channel; //# sourceMappingURL=acquireReleaseWith.d.ts.map